Traveler's Microsoft Account Security: Navigating Unusual Activity Alerts

Are you a frequent traveler constantly encountering "We have detected unusual activity on your Microsoft account" alerts? This can be a frustrating experience. Microsoft implements these security measures to protect your account, but they can be triggered when you log in from different locations.

This article provides practical steps to minimize these alerts while ensuring your account's security, allowing you to travel with peace of mind.

Essential Steps to Prevent "Unusual Activity" Notifications

To avoid repeated "unusual activity" notifications, consider these key actions:

1. Update Your Security Information: Ensure your recovery information, like alternate email addresses and phone numbers, is current. This allows Microsoft to verify your identity more easily when you log in from unfamiliar locations.

2.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): 2FA adds an extra layer of security. It requires a second verification method (like a code sent to your phone) in addition to your password. This safeguards your account even if your password is compromised.

3. Consider a Virtual Private Network (VPN): Using a VPN encrypts your internet connection and masks your location, potentially reducing the likelihood of triggering the "unusual activity" alert. This can make it appear you are logging in from a familiar location.
